/- IP.Bus.SBUS — Futaba S.BUS frame encoder/decoder. S.BUS is an inverted-UART 100 000 baud / 8E2 (1 start + 8 data LSB-first + 1 even parity + 2 stop) serial bus used to drive servos and (more relevantly here) deliver RC channel data from a receiver to a flight controller. Frame format (25 bytes, ~3 ms on the wire at 100 kbps): byte 0 : 0x0F (header) bytes 1..22 (22 bytes = 176 bits): 16 channels × 11 bits, channel 0 LSB-first in bytes 1..2..3.. ↘ packed byte 23 : flags (bits below) byte 24 : 0x00 (footer) Flag byte (byte 23): bit 0 digital channel 17 (ch17) bit 1 digital channel 18 (ch18) bit 2 frame lost (radio lost telemetry to controller) bit 3 failsafe activated (controller lost link to model) bits 4..7 reserved (0) Channel value range: 0..2047 (11-bit unsigned). Typical mapping: 1000 = -100 %, 1500 = neutral, 2000 = +100 %. This module ships pure-data builder/parser. The channels are concatenated bit-wise: channel 0 occupies bits 0..10, channel 1 bits 11..21, …, channel 15 bits 165..175. Each output byte i (0..21) takes bits [8·i .. 8·i + 7] of that bitstream. -/ def packChannels (channels : Array Nat) : Array UInt8 := Id.run do -- Concatenate all 16×11 bits into one 176-bit Nat (LSB first). let mut bits : Nat := 0 for i in [:16] do let v := if h : i < channels.size then channels[i]! &&& 0x7FF else 0 bits := bits ||| (v <<< (i * 11)) -- Split into 22 bytes. let mut out : Array UInt8 := Array.replicate 22 0 for i in [:22] do out := out.set! i (UInt8.ofNat ((bits >>> (i * 8)) &&& 0xFF)) return out /-- Reverse of `packChannels`: extract 16 × 11-bit channels from 22 bytes. -/ def unpackChannels (bytes : Array UInt8) : Array Nat := Id.run do let mut bits : Nat := 0 for i in [:22] do let b := if h : i < bytes.size then bytes[i]!.toNat else 0 bits := bits ||| (b <<< (i * 8)) let mut out : Array Nat := Array.replicate 16 0 for i in [:16] do out := out.set! i ((bits >>> (i * 11)) &&& 0x7FF) return out /-- Build the 25-byte on-wire S.BUS frame. -/ def buildFrame (f : Frame) : Array UInt8 := #[headerByte] ++ packChannels f.channels ++ #[encodeFlags f.ch17 f.ch18 f.frameLost f.failsafe, footerByte] /-- Parse a 25-byte S.BUS frame.
